Transaction 6859707e57c31b3591167deffd6b0b4837693bd268ed1a175e80e01af5f803ac

2 Input
2 Outputs
  • 6859707e57c31b3591167deffd6b0b4837693bd268ed1a175e80e01af5f803ac:0
  • value  2350032
    address  1BLQp54xqVSJXyBsai8KtedFjVi3mGfRXG
  • 6859707e57c31b3591167deffd6b0b4837693bd268ed1a175e80e01af5f803ac:1
  • value  45666298
    address  17hezBzK2kekcCaGdwNDph74Vwxcic3rsp